The Ongoing Development of Independent Palestinian Television

Period: June 2008 – December 2009

These shows were designed to provide a range of programming that would appeal to different sectors of the population and expand the public debate. The project was also designed to support the development of independent media in Palestine through human and technical capacity building, and most of these programs were produced in partnership with Ma'an Network’s member stations and Gaza office.

Results:

Ma'an Network produced and broadcast two series of Hard Questions (for a total of 48 episodes) and three other series of original productions: For Your Health, Eyes on Gaza and Our Economy.

 Program: Hard Questions (Al-As'ila As-Saaba)

      Duration: 60 minutes

      Presented by: Nasser Lahham,  Ma'an News Agency

     Editor-in-Chief

      Aired: Mondays at 9:00pm

    Description: A news magazine program hosted by Nasser Lahham that looks beyond the headlines and probes news-makers and political personalities for the facts behind the news. By asking the “hard questions,” Lahham gives his Palestinian audiences access to in-depth information on the political process and decision making. With guests including prominent Palestinian and Israeli figures, Lahham delves into issues surrounding regional politics and the conflict as well as the Palestinian political scene. The format of the second series of Hard Questions included more emphasis on in-depth investigative features.

Program: Our Economy (Iqtisaduna)

Duration: 60 minutes

Presented by: Anis Swidan

Aired: Fridays at 9:00pm

Description: Bringing stories of Palestinian business success, innovation and struggle to a local audience, Our Economy targets issues that affect the development of commerce and business in the region. Tapping into the expertise of professors, lawyers, businessmen/women and lawmakers, the show probes topical issues impacting economic development, presenting detailed economic information in an accessible manner.

Program: Eyes on Gaza (Ayoun ala' Gaza)

Duration: 60 minutes

Presented by: Mona Okal

Aired: Sundays at 9:00pm

Description: Feature programs detailing the realities of life in the Gaza Strip. Presenting stories of pain, hope, and struggle, these documentary-style broadcasts look at the lives of citizens in Gaza. Each broadcast tackles a new issue, and traces the ways different people deal with the situation. The program has covered food shortages, post-traumatic stress, the effect of regular airstrikes on daily life, and dealing with the death of loved ones. However, the program also strives to give viewers a multi-dimensional picture of life in Gaza by focusing on the work of artists, reporters, medical professionals, teachers, and civil society organizations throughout the Strip.

 Program: For Your Health (Sahtak Ilak)

Duration: 60 minutes

Presented by: Muna Hawash

Aired: Sundays at 5:00pm

Description: Experts, doctors, nurses and researchers weigh in on a wide range of health issues. From treatment of childhood illnesses to preventing the spread of infections, the show is a resource and practical educational tool for households across Palestine.
